Imants Tillers is recognised as one of Australia's most intriguing and compelling artists. This monograph, the first major publication on his art, provides an overview of his career and a detailed introduction to the works he has produced since 1981, collectively known as the 'Book of Power'. The text shows how, as Tillers reflected on and became engaged in the distribution and circulation of visual imagery, he developed into a true artist of the age of information. He has been remakably prolific and few readers will be aware of the size and range of the output discussed here - more than 100 works are reproduced. [Blurb]
